Output 59041446b61272268b0d383b642c040b8109da72c96594ff6b93e94607bb536c:2

value
12855296
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b829e236d8c7a11f0656d8bb4a405b847ed30f0 OP_EQUAL
address
MGF2CNAA5GjGkPnrTqwtX16yzQdP5Q2soU
transaction
59041446b61272268b0d383b642c040b8109da72c96594ff6b93e94607bb536c
spent
true